How do I get a daily summary of my Adyen settlements and declines?

WebRun checks your Adyen account every morning for yesterday's settled payouts and declined payments, then posts a short digest to Slack and pings Telegram only when the decline rate looks unusual. It never moves money itself, so your finance team starts the day with a clear read on payment health.

Will WebRun move money or issue a payout itself?

No. WebRun never sends a payment, issues a refund, or transfers funds on its own. It only reads Adyen's settlement and decline data, reports on it, and leaves any payout or refund for you to approve.

How is the decline rate calculated?

It compares today's declined and failed payments against your recent average from live Adyen data, so the Telegram ping only fires when the rate is genuinely unusual.

Does it change anything inside Adyen?

No. It only reads settlement and transaction data. It never edits a payment, disputes a chargeback, or changes an account setting.
